Licensing, Documentation and Ethics for School Nurses




      


Presented by Elvin W. Houston with Walsh Gallegos

Mr. Houston will provide a unique training designed specifically for school nurses and those educators who work closely with issues of school nursing.  His presentation will explain each school district’s obligation to meet the needs of students with disabilities from the standpoint of understanding the nurse’s role in attending Admission, Review and Dismissal (ARD) Committee meetings, serving students under IDEA and Section 504, and conducting necessary evaluations required by federal and state education laws.  Mr. Houston’s presentation will include review of topics such a school district’s obligations related to delegable duties, school nursing services under an IEP, private duty nurses on-campuses, and how to address parent concerns while complying with the law.
